Buyer-review evidence is limited (one rating and one brief write-up), so patterns around performance, long-term anti-aging results, and skin-type compatibility are hard to confirm. Still, the available feedback is consistent on a few practical points: the cream texture is described as very thick at first, then it spreads and absorbs after rubbing. The reviewer also reported that it felt “heavy” immediately after application, then became more comfortable as it set. On visible effects, the review claims a small improvement in fine lines and a brighter skin tone over a couple of weeks, alongside a skin feel that becomes tighter or more toned. The main complaint is packaging, since it comes in a jar with a spoon rather than a pump.

Packaging and routine fit

The cream is packaged in a jar with a spoon for scooping product. That matters for day-to-day convenience and hygiene preferences. If you strongly prefer pump bottles to reduce frequent finger contact, you may want to factor this into your decision even if you like the texture and finish.

Also, the product is described as part of a broader skincare routine. If you already use the brand’s toner, essence, emulsion, and eye cream, this can align well with how you build steps. If you prefer a simple single-moisturizer routine, you can still use it, but you may not get the full “system” approach the brand implies.
